>> The MHI driver does not work on big endian architectures.  The
>> controller never transitions into mission mode.  This appears to be
>> due
>> to the modem device expecting the various contexts and transfer rings
>> to
>> have fields in little endian order in memory, but the driver
>> constructs
>> them in native endianness.
>> 
>> Fix MHI event, channel and command contexts and TRE handling macros
>> to
>> use explicit conversion to little endian.  Mark fields in relevant
>> structures as little endian to document this requirement.
